This paper proposes a camera-based visibility estimation method for a traffic sign. The visibility here indicates how a visual target is easy to be detected and recognized by a human driver (not a machine). This research aims at realizing a nuisance-free driver assistance system which sorts out information depending on the visibility of a visual target, in order to prevent driver distraction. Our previous study on estimating the visibility of a traffic sign considered only the effect of the local region around a target, assuming the situation that a driver's gaze is around it. The proposed method integrates both the local features and global features in a driving environment without such an assumption. The global features evaluate the positional relationships between traffic signs and the appearance around the fixation point of a driver's gaze, which considers the effect of the driver's entire field of view. Experimental results showed the effectiveness of incorporating the global features for estimating the visibility of a traffic sign.
